Output 26392fcdd39517d9d87b279cddbac17328a55de83a31a8f5c6621497a39b3403:0

value
17638593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b91f35ce9d8a4b43c2c02a0b0c5ba108c481f51b OP_EQUALVERIFY OP_CHECKSIG
address
1HsqQ1bQ59UtYBfWx1gTpXdwzQyY4ifrvp
transaction
26392fcdd39517d9d87b279cddbac17328a55de83a31a8f5c6621497a39b3403
spent
true